Picked up my new MYP and noticed the steering wheel points to the right ever so slightly to go straight. Doesn’t pull to either side but I submitted a service ticket to see if they can do a better job aligning the vehicle/reset steering wheel angle.

Tech drove the car and said no issues found, but did alignment as a courtesy. Ended up finding “multiple values out of spec”. Steering issue was fixed after alignment.

Just posting as a PSA - you may want to get an alignment check sooner than later as there have been several reports of premature tire wear. Especially with replacement tires at $1500+ per set…most places will check alignment for free.

There haven't really been any MYPs that have abnormal premature tire wear here - people are just surprised that they only get 10-20k out of a set of rear tires. The alignment is rarely to blame.

When the wheel is pointed straight on the alignment rack, the values show as "red" because the car was originally aligned with the wheel off-center in Fremont. But, the car's wheels are "aligned" in relation to each other. The person that aligned it just didn't set the wheel at 0º when they did it. Mine has the exact same issue as yours, and tire wear is normal so far at 6500 miles.
